@OP, modelling is NOT as easy as you think. Its a career on its own and definitely not for people without a passion for it. It takes time, lots of dedication and hard work to break into the industry and get your first job.
You are pretty but just below average in the "modelling world".

Look for a renowned modelling agency and register. Be careful of time wasters.
